The Return of Bug-Eye Sunglasses: Fashion's Bold Statement for 2026
The spring/summer 2026 fashion shows delivered a powerful visual message that resonated across runways and red carpets: bug-eye sunglasses are officially back. This dramatic eyewear trend, characterized by oversized, rounded frames that envelop the eye area, has re-emerged as a dominant force in contemporary fashion.
Runway Revival and Celebrity Embrace
On international catwalks, models confidently showcased collections featuring exaggerated bug-eye sunglasses from prestigious luxury labels including Balenciaga, Loewe, and Saint Laurent. These designs presented modern interpretations of the classic silhouette, often pushing proportions to new extremes. The runway momentum quickly translated to celebrity adoption, with style icons like Miley Cyrus, Dan Levy, and Lady Gaga incorporating these statement pieces into their summer wardrobes, signaling the trend's transition from high fashion to mainstream appeal.
A Vintage Revival with Modern Meaning
This resurgence represents more than just cyclical fashion; it's a meaningful revival of a style that first gained prominence during the 1960s and 1970s. Celebrity fashion stylist Mitali Amberkar explains, "These sunglasses originally served as a silent statement of power and dominance. Their contemporary return marks a significant shift from the understated aesthetics of quiet luxury toward more expressive, personality-driven style."
Luxury fashion stylist Meghna Ghodawat adds, "In today's visually saturated world, there's comfort in accessories that provide privacy. Bug-eye sunglasses create that protective cocoon, softening your surroundings while maintaining elegance through selective revelation."
Defining the Bug-Eye Aesthetic
Bug-eye sunglasses are distinguished by their generously oversized, predominantly rounded frames that comprehensively cover the eye region, often extending toward the cheekbones and temples. The name derives from their distinctive resemblance to insect eyes. Beyond their striking appearance, these sunglasses offer practical benefits including maximum ultraviolet protection.
Mitali Amberkar emphasizes, "Bug-eye sunglasses transcend temporary trend status to become a visual declaration about contemporary fashion identity. They successfully merge style with functionality while projecting an aura of mystery, playfulness, and confidence."
Versatile Styling Possibilities
The inherent versatility of bug-eye sunglasses allows for adaptation across diverse fashion aesthetics. Amberkar recommends pairing them with clean, tailored silhouettes such as structured blazers and trousers, complemented by slicked-back hair for a polished, sophisticated effect. Conversely, they create compelling contrast when styled with flouncy garments and voluminous hairstyles for a maximalist, statement-making look.
For optimal impact, these frames shine brightest when the accompanying outfit maintains sharp, clean, and minimal lines—think monochromatic coordinates or elevated athleisure wear. Pulled-back hairstyles and restrained accessories allow the sunglasses to command attention as the focal point. Experimental stylists can explore tinted lenses or metallic and reflective finishes to introduce playful dimensions.
Proportional Considerations
Successful styling requires attention to facial proportions. Individuals with smaller facial features should consider slightly scaled-down bug-eye variations, while those with larger facial structures can confidently embrace fully oversized frames. This proportional awareness ensures the sunglasses enhance rather than overwhelm the wearer's natural features.
